An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Non-Destructive Evaluation (NDE) Engineer - Manufacturing to join our team in Derby.

As an NDE Engineer - Manufacturing, you will use your knowledge and expertise in development and application of NDT techniques across the product lifecycle. The role involves maintaining and managing acceptable risk levels in the NDT Supply Chain of Rolls-Royce through process auditing, consultancy, approval in production, and technology development focused on efficiency, quality, and cost goals.

You will be part of our NDE Laboratory within the Global Materials Engineering function, supporting Civil Aerospace, Business Aviation, and Defence Aerospace sectors. Our laboratory covers the full lifecycle of engine products, from development to service, providing advice and guidance on NDE matters to other engineering disciplines.

What you will be doing
  • Analyzing information from multiple sources to identify effective solutions using your technical expertise and engineering judgment.
  • Providing technical support and consultancy for product development in future programs.
  • Supporting, maintaining, and improving our internal and external supply chain for NDE processes.
  • Auditing and risk assessing our supply chain against NDT procedures and processes.
  • Representing the company with suppliers and customers.
  • Promoting contin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Participating in global NDE organization activities to drive change and advancement.
  • Mentoring NDT Degree Apprentices throughout their training.
